Ser pan comido

Used to describe a task or situation that is extremely easy to complete. It is the direct equivalent of the English 'piece of cake' or 'easy as pie.'

🗣️

Examples in context

El examen de ayer fue pan comido.

Yesterday's exam was a piece of cake.

Arreglar este grifo será pan comido.

Fixing this faucet will be a breeze.
